南丹长坡尾矿坝五种植物富集重金属的生态调查

摘    要:为寻找适合矿业尾矿废弃地生态恢复和植物修复的植物,有效的进行矿业尾矿废弃地植被生态恢复,本文调查分析广西南丹长坡矿堆存50年之久的尾矿坝上的灯心草、节节草、类芦、莎草和醉鱼草的覆盖度、生物量以及植物体内的重金属含量.结果表明:这5种植物覆盖度超过40%,高度超过40 cm,为该尾矿坝的优势植物.且具有较高生物量,特别是类芦、灯心草和莎草,生物量均超过20 g-株(干重),说明这些植物适合尾矿坝环境,对重金属有很高耐性.5种植物中,类芦地上部分Zn含量最高为286.45 mg/kg,醉鱼草地上部分Pb和Cd含量最高,分别为148.46 mg/kg和5.54 mg-kg,都未达到超富集植物标准,考虑到高生物量和重金属的耐性,这5种植物在矿废弃地生态恢复和植物修复中都有一定应用价值.此外,5种植物对重金属的转运能力有较大差异,其中醉鱼草对3种重金属的转运系数均超过1,其转运机理值得进一步探讨.
